Despite its small size, Sandbach Train Station offers a variety of facilities to ensure a convenient travel experience. The station features a ticket office open from Monday to Saturday, with ticket machines available for those who prefer quick service or need to collect tickets purchased online. Accessibility is a priority here, with induction loops, step-free access to certain areas, and accessible ticket machines to assist passengers with limited mobility. However, there are some limitations, such as the absence of public Wi-Fi, cashpoints, and refreshment facilities. Travellers will also find no waiting rooms or toilets at the station, so it's advisable to plan accordingly before embarking on your journey.
For those looking to venture beyond the station, travel links from Sandbach connect you seamlessly to other transport modes. Positioned at the front of the station, a rail replacement service departs during times of disruption, ensuring continuity in travel plans. For those preferring road transport, taxis can be booked through platforms like Northern Railway's Cab4You service. Buses serve local routes to Middlewich, Winsford, and Sandbach town centre, with convenient stops just 100 yards away on London Road.

At Grange-over-Sands Station, facilities are designed to cater to both seasoned commuters and first-time travellers alike. The station offers a convenient ticket office open from 06:15 to 19:45 on weekdays and from 09:15 to 18:00 on Sundays. Additionally, ticket machines are available for quick purchases and online ticket collections, all equipped with accessible features.
For those needing assistance, help is at hand from Monday through to Sunday, ensuring that travel is as stress-free as possible. The station provides step-free access throughout its entirety, making it friendly for users with mobility challenges. Passengers are welcomed to relax in available seating areas, although there is no designated waiting room.
While there is no dedicated luggage storage facility, customers can access help points for detailed travel assistance. To ensure safety, CCTV cameras are installed at the station. Refreshments and some shopping options are conveniently available, even though currency exchange and ATMs are absent.
For parking, the station opens its car park 24 hours a day, offering 33 general spaces and 2 accessible ones. Parking fees are competitive, letting you focus more on the adventures ahead. For those on two wheels, bicycle stands are available on Platforms 1 and 2, although these aren’t sheltered.
